InnoDB is a MySQL database storage engine, which has been gaining popularity in recent years, as it offers a much better overall performance and an improved crash recovery in comparison to the default engine used by the MySQL DBMS – MyISAM. InnoDB is used by plenty of devs that run scalable software apps, as it works much more efficiently with immense data volumes, while it keeps the server load at a minimum. Additionally, it uses row-level locking in case any info should be modified, whereas many other engines lock the entire table and thus need more time to process multiple sequential tasks. Last, but not least, InnoDB complies with a set of "all-or-nothing" rules – if the entire data modification procedure cannot be completed for whatever reason, the operation is rolled back to avoid scrambling or losing data. Magento and the newest releases of Joomla are two instances of widespread PHP script-powered software platforms that have shifted over to InnoDB.

InnoDB in Hosting

InnoDB is available with all our Linux hosting by default, not as a paid upgrade or upon request, so you can activate and manage any open-source script-driven software app that requires the InnoDB storage engine without encountering any impediment as soon as you open your shared website hosting account. InnoDB will be pre-selected as the default engine for a certain MySQL database during the app activation process, regardless of whether you use our one-click installer or create the MySQL database and install the app manually, as long as the app requires it instead of the more famous MyISAM engine. We will create regular database backups, so you can rest assured that you will never lose any data in case you delete a database unintentionally or you overwrite some vital info – you will just have to get in touch with us and we’ll restore your content back to normal.

InnoDB in Semi-dedicated Hosting

All our Linux semi-dedicated hosting include InnoDB and you can make the most of all the options offered by this MySQL database storage engine with any PHP-driven web application that requires it. It is among the engines that we have on our cloud website hosting platform, so the one that will be selected depends on the requirements of the specific application. You will not need to do anything manually to activate InnoDB, as it will be set as the default engine whenever you install an application – whether manually or using our one-click app installer. To avoid any risk, we will generate regular backups of all your databases, so if anything goes wrong after some update or if you erase some content unintentionally, we’ll be able to get your database back to the way it was on any of the past 7 days.

InnoDB in VPS Web Hosting

All Linux VPS web hosting that are ordered with the Hepsia Control Panel come with InnoDB pre-installed, so you’ll be able to take advantage of any script-based web application that needs this storage engine without the need to configure anything manually. You can pick Hepsia on the VPS order page and your brand new VPS server will be ready within 1 hour, so you can log in and start setting up your websites straight away. When you create a brand-new MySQL database and begin the app installation process, our system will choose the engine for this database automatically. Thus, you can manage various apps simultaneously without the need to edit anything on the server. You can create a WordPress personal journal that uses MyISAM – the default MySQL engine, and a Magento-based web store that makes use of the InnoDB engine, for instance.

InnoDB in Dedicated Servers Hosting

InnoDB is available by default with all Linux dedicated servers hosting ordered with the Hepsia hosting Control Panel. It is an essential part of the default software package that will be installed on all Hepsia-managed dedicated servers, so as soon as your machine is assembled, you’ll be able to sign in and to install a various PHP script-based web application that requires this particular MySQL database engine. If you create a new MySQL database via the hosting Control Panel, there won’t be any activated engine till you begin installing an application. As soon as the app installation wizard starts entering content into the newly created database, the engine will be chosen automatically on the basis of the given app’s prerequisites, so you can run both MyISAM and InnoDB without having to select either one explicitly at any moment. Therefore, you can make use of a huge range of applications for your Internet sites.